Thanks to a heads-up from [livejournal.com profile] auryanne, I now know why someone posted (on my youtube vid) that there -are- female worgen in World of Warcraft: there is a big rumor that one of the next player-races could be the Worgen . If the ones discussing this are right, it's possible that the Worgen race would be an -Alliance- race, too! Goblins=Horde; Worgen=Alliance because of balance, their origins beyond Arugal's summoning and the fact that the masks look more poofy than current worgen design. Alliance Worgen?! Weird.

In Silverpine forest there is a walled-off area called Gilneas. It's rumored that they all became Worgen. I don't know what to make of it myself... personally I will not be surprised if Worgen/Goblins (if they are the new races) can be either Alliance or Horde.
